Dutchess county
the new route will use the Walkway Over The Hudson as the Hudson River crossing between the City of Poughkeepsie (Dutchess county)
and the village of Highland (Ulster county)
the new route will now use an 8 mile portion of the Harlem Valley RT between Amenia and Milerton
the new route will favor "yuppie" B&B type touring cyclists - all camping in Dutchess county will be off route - the new route will
no longer go past Mills - Norrie SP on US rt. 9 in Staatsburg
the new route will eliminate the long ride along US rt. 9 from Staatsburg however,the section of US rt. 9 from the village of Hyde Park
to Marist College,is still being used
the new route crosses SR 9G in the town of Hyde Park giving an optional route to the above FYI: SR 9G becomes Parker
Ave. in the City of Poughkeepsie - the east end entrance of the WOTH state park is on Parker Ave. (SR 9G)
the new route goes across the very scenic central part of Dutchess County
view along the new route in Dutchess county - CR41 town of Pleasant Valley
Ulster county
after crossing the Hudson river via the Walkway Over The Hudson state park the new route will use the
expanded Hudson Valley Rail Trail and then a revised route from New Paltz into farm country of NW Orange county
Orange county
the new route through Orange county avoids the economicaly depressed center city of Middletown NY
